Salem Township is one of twelve townships in Steuben County, Indiana, United States. As of the 2020 census, its population was 2,189, down from 2,262 at 2010,[1] and it contained 1,144 housing units.

Cemeteries

The township contains six cemeteries: Block, Circle, County Line, Hollister, Trinity and Wright.
